Michelle Williams is a mom of four.
The actress, 44, quietly welcomed her fourth child, her third with husband Thomas Kail.
A source tells People that the baby was delivered via surrogate six weeks ago.

“They couldn’t be happier to expand their family, and Matilda has been doting on her younger siblings,” the insider said, referring to Williams’ eldest child, daughter Matilda, 19.
The Post reached out to Williams’ rep for comment.
The news comes on the heels of Williams and Kail stepping out together for the New York City premiere of the star’s new FX on Hulu show “Dying for Sex” on Wednesday.
Williams — who nabbed the lead role in the dramedy — wore a lavender chiffon gown, while the director, 48, donned a classic black suit. Williams plays a woman with terminal cancer who decides to go on sexual escapades after receiving her diagnosis. The series is based on a podcast and the real story of Molly Kochan, who passed away in 2019 at age 45.
Williams and Kail tied the knot in 2020 after meeting on the set of the FX series “Fosse/Verdon” in 2018.
The couple are also parents to son Hart, 4. They were expecting their second child together in 2022 when the actress took a moment to gush over her pregnancy.

She told Variety, “It’s totally joyous.”
“As the years go on, you sort of wonder what they might hold for you or not hold for you. It’s exciting to discover that something you want again and again is available one more time,” Williams continued. “That good fortune is not lost on me or my family.”
A year later, Williams got candid about starring in Steven Spielberg’s personal family drama “The Fabelmans” after giving birth to her third child.
“My heart obviously belongs to my children; they tug at it the most,” she said. “But I really want to be able to have both [family and a career]. And I think that it requires deep thought and learning and the support of other women to figure out how to get through it.”
After the birth, a source told Us Weekly how Kail had become a constant presence in Matilda’s life throughout the years.
“Matilda is a very mature and intelligent young lady,” the insider said in 2022. “They wouldn’t change a single thing about their life together.”
Williams, who has dated Jason Segel, Spike Jonze and financial consultant Andrew Youmans, was previously married to musician Phil Elverum before her romance with Kail. The exes secretly married in 2018 and split the following year.
“I never gave up on love,” she told Vanity Fair in 2018. “I always say to Matilda, ‘Your dad loved me before anybody thought I was talented, or pretty, or had nice clothes.’”
